Transaction 32b18156b4dd371578e6a7fc5c7a4f328c014692ddd97d9b12d70ade3b817348

2 Input
2 Outputs
  • 32b18156b4dd371578e6a7fc5c7a4f328c014692ddd97d9b12d70ade3b817348:0
  • value  132000000
    address  1Apd8w7J41ZM4BGioHqA4qLEqWW5yhjrW8
  • 32b18156b4dd371578e6a7fc5c7a4f328c014692ddd97d9b12d70ade3b817348:1
  • value  23833
    address  1KVL33MQ5McYeTZrTQ7Y3xrpsdCEqGURq7